Ord 6785 04/02/2025 Amending Ordinance No. 3831 Granting A Conditional Use In The Nature Of A Planned Unit Development For Property Commonly Known As Lake Center Plaza, Amended By Ord 5617 For Property at 500 West Algonquin Road, Mount Prospect, IL
ORDINANCE NO.6785 AN ORDINANCE AMENDING ORDINANCE NO.3831 GRANTING A CONDITIONAL USE IN THE NATURE OF A PLANNED UNIT DEVELOPMENT FOR PROPERTY COMMONLY KNOWN AS LAKE CENTER PLAZA, AMENDED BY ORDINANCE NO.5617, FOR PROPERTY LOCATED AT WHEREAS, by Ordinance No. 3831, the Corporate Authorities of the Village of Mount Prospect approved a conditional use permit for the Lake Center Plaza Planned Unit Development; and WHEREAS, by Ordinance No. 5617, the Lake Center Plaza Planned Unit Development was amended; and WHEREAS, AGL 500 West LLC ("Petitioner"), filed an application for a conditional use to amend the Lake Center Plaza Planned Unit Development, pursuant to Section 14.504(E)(1) of the Village Code, to construct a new building and related site modifications for the property commonly known as 500 West Algonquin Road ("Subject Property") and part of the Lake Center Plaza Planned Unit Development in the Village of Mount Prospect, Illinois and Legally described as: LOT 1 IN LAKE CENTER PLAZA RESUBDIVISION NO. 2 OF PART OF THE NORTHEAST 114 OF SECTION 23 TOWNSHIP 41 NORTH RANGE 11 EAST OF THE THIRD PRINCIPAL MERIDIAN, IN COOK COUNTY, ILLINOIS. PIN: 08-23-203-037-0000; and WHEREAS, a public hearing was held on the request for a conditional use to amend the Lake Center Plaza Planned Unit Development being the subject of PZ-02-25 before the Planning and Zoning Commission of the Village of Mount Prospect on the 13th day of March, 2025, pursuant to proper legal notice having been published in the Daily Herald newspaper on the 26th day of February, 2025;and WHEREAS, the Planning and Zoning Commission has submitted its findings and recommendations of approval, with specific conditions, to the Mayor and Board of Trustees in support of the request being the subject of PZ-02-25; and WHEREAS, the Mayor and Board of Trustees of the Village of Mount Prospect have given consideration to the request herein and have determined that the same meets the standards of the Village and that the granting of the proposed conditional use to amend the planned unit development would be in the best interest of the Village.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E MAYOR AND BOARD OF TRUSTEES OF THE VILLAGE OF MOUNT PROSPECT, COOK COUNTY, ILLINOIS ACTING IN THE EXERCISE OF THEIR HOME RULE POWERS: 5..TMC.�.That the recitals set forth hereinabove are incorporated herein as findings of fact by the Mayor and Board of Trustees of the Village of Mount Prospect. S CT_ ►N T,WO; The Mayor and Board of Trustees of the Village of Mount Prospect do hereby grant a conditional use to amend Ord. 3831 and Ord. 5617 of the Lake Center Plaza Planned Unit Development to construct a 5,500 square foot warehouse, update the existing light industrial building, and complete related site modifications at 500 West Algonquin Road, Case No. PZ- 02-25, subject to the following conditions: 1. The subject property shall be developed in strict compliance with the approved development plans which will consist of the following: a. Architectural plans entitled "Proposed Remodeling for Broadway Electric / Cornerstone Contracting Inc", 5 pages, as prepared by Wojcik + Associates Architects, Inc bearing the latest revision date March 18, 2025; b. Landscape plans entitled "Broadway Electric / Cornerstone Contracting Inc", 5 pages, as prepared by Pamela Self, bearing the latest revision date February 26, 2025; 2. Parking for commercial vehicles shall be restricted to the following locations: a. The area designated in the site plan; or b. Inside the warehouse. 3. The petitioner shall address all comments included in the Village review Letter dated February 25, 2025; 4. A fully compliant photometric plan will be required as part of the building permit submittal; 5. A fully compliant signage proposal will be required for the sign permit submittal; and 6. Compliance with all applicable development, fire, building, and other Village Codes and regulations. Except for the amendment to the planned unit development request granted herein, all other applicable Village of Mount Prospect, Illinois ordinances and regulations shall remain in full force and effect as to the subject property. ±TJTHEE' The Village Clerk is hereby authorized and directed to record a certified copy of this Ordinance and Exhibits "A," "B," and "C" with the Recorder of Deeds of Cook County. SE! T* E R.:. This Ordinance shall be in full force and effect from and after its passage, approval and publication in pamphlet form in the manner provided by law. Cassady VILLAGE CLERK Karen Agoranos Phone: 847/962-6000 Fax:847/962-6022 www.mountprospect.org The Village of Mount Prospect has reviewed the second submittal for a major amendment to the Lake Center Plaza PUD at 500 West Algonquin Road, Mount Prospect. Staff has the following review comments: Planning Division: Items to be revised prior to Village Board hearing: 1. Please move the overnight parking information from the schematic landscape plan (LS-3) to the conceptual site plan (LS-1). 2. Verify that the existing transformer and new generator will be under 6' tall. 3. Provide fence elevations for the trash enclosure. 4. Provide landscape screening around the trash enclosure fence. 5. Provide at minimum 120 square feet of live landscaping coverage at the islands at the end of each parking row. See red circles. ..� � �" �� I� wry u EXHIBIT C Village of Mount Prospect I Page 2 6. Provide the monument sign face square footage. A minimum of two square feet of landscaping is required for every one square foot of sign face. 7. No new RTUs are indicated or approved for the new or existing building. 8. A complete revised set of plans bearing the latest revision date will need to be provided and reviewed by staff prior to scheduling the Village Board meeting. Items to be revised prior to building permit submittal: 9. It is noted that the existing exterior light fixtures will be replaced, including 4 pole -mounted Lights, 2 wall mounted lights, and 3 bollard lights. The light poles will remain. The ground mounted lights (10 total) will be removed. As a condition of approval, a fully compliant Photometric plan will be required as part of building permit submittal. 10. All signs shall meet the standards of Chapter 7 of the Village Code. 11. A business license application shall be submitted with the building permit. Business operations shall meet the performance standards related to noise, vibrations, smoke, fire hazard, toxic matter, odorous matter, and glare listed in Section 14.2101. Public Works Department: No PW issues regarding the requested Conditional Use to construct a new warehouse on site, subject to the following conditions to be addressed prior to issuing the Building Permit: 12. No new utilities are shown on the plan. If water (including fire protection) or sanitary services are to be installed to the new warehouse, they must be shown on the site plan. 13. Sheet LS-1 seems to show the entry walks to be brick, and the driveways to the garage doors to be concrete. Confirm, and provide details on the site plan. If the brick is to be permeable, an Operation & Maintenance Plan shall be required. 14. A grading plan will be required showingthe new pavement grades, and drainage patterns. 15. If a sanitaryservice is desired, itwill have to be permitted bythe Metropolitan Water Reclamation District of Greater Chicago (MWRD). If any changes to the driveway onto Algonquin Road are desired, theywill have to be permitted by the Illinois Department of Transportation (IDOT). Building Department: 16. When plans come in for a building permit, please note that necessary, structural, and MEP shall be included in the submittal package. If a floor or trench drain is added anywhere, please add an FOG intercept as needed. Will confirm IECC design and permit review. 17. Any existing structural repair will require third partytesting report or Village of Mount Prospect on -site inspection. EXHIBIT C Village of Mount Prospect i Page 3 Fire Department: Please advise the petitioner the following items must be included in the building/site plans submittal: 18. Afire sprinkler system in accordance with NFPA 13will be required for this projectfor all buildings. Ensure fire sprinkler shop drawings, hydraulic calculations, and equipment cut sheets are submitted for review. (Village of Mount Prospect Fire Prevention Code, 24.20) 19.Afire alarm system will be requi red for this project. Ensure fire alarm shop drawings with point-to-pointwiringdiagrams, batterytoad calculations, and equipmentcut sheets are submitted for review. 20.An egress plan must be provided for the entire building. This plan must include occupant loads, travel distances, egress widths, and common path of travel distances. An egress plan will be required when the building plans are submitted for review. Additional exits may be required. 21. All egress doors are to use keyless locksets on the egress side. No flush bolts, dead or draw bolts, etc. will be allowed.
